1. 31 Dec, 2008 2 commits
  2. 30 Dec, 2008 7 commits
  3. 29 Dec, 2008 8 commits
  4. 28 Dec, 2008 4 commits
  5. 27 Dec, 2008 19 commits
    • Georg Brandl's avatar
      Document bytes.translate(). · 454636f0
      Georg Brandl authored
      BTW, having str.maketrans() as a static method and
      string.maketrans() as a function that creates translation tables for bytes objects is not very consistent :)
      454636f0
    • Georg Brandl's avatar
      09923f3b
    • Antoine Pitrou's avatar
      Merged revisions 67965 via svnmerge from · 2a013eac
      Antoine Pitrou authored
      svn+ssh://pythondev@svn.python.org/python/trunk
      
      ........
        r67965 | antoine.pitrou | 2008-12-27 21:34:52 +0100 (sam., 27 déc. 2008) | 3 lines
      
        Issue #4677: add two list comprehension tests to pybench.
      ........
      2a013eac
    • Alexandre Vassalotti's avatar
    • Georg Brandl's avatar
      7d41890d
    • Benjamin Peterson's avatar
      Merged revisions 67954 via svnmerge from · 371ccfb5
      Benjamin Peterson authored
      svn+ssh://pythondev@svn.python.org/python/trunk
      
      ........
        r67954 | benjamin.peterson | 2008-12-27 12:24:11 -0600 (Sat, 27 Dec 2008) | 1 line
      
        #4748 lambda generators shouldn't return values
      ........
      371ccfb5
    • Benjamin Peterson's avatar
      fix svnmerge properties · 5cdee16e
      Benjamin Peterson authored
      5cdee16e
    • Benjamin Peterson's avatar
      fix 2.x isms in distutils test · 467a7bd2
      Benjamin Peterson authored
      467a7bd2
    • Benjamin Peterson's avatar
      fix syntax · d148630e
      Benjamin Peterson authored
      d148630e
    • Benjamin Peterson's avatar
      Merged revisions... · 9203501b
      Benjamin Peterson authored
      Merged revisions 67889-67892,67895,67898,67904-67907,67912,67918,67920-67921,67923-67924,67926-67927,67930,67943 via svnmerge from
      svn+ssh://pythondev@svn.python.org/python/trunk
      
      ................
        r67889 | benjamin.peterson | 2008-12-20 19:04:32 -0600 (Sat, 20 Dec 2008) | 1 line
      
        sphinx.web is long gone
      ................
        r67890 | benjamin.peterson | 2008-12-20 19:12:26 -0600 (Sat, 20 Dec 2008) | 1 line
      
        update readme
      ................
        r67891 | benjamin.peterson | 2008-12-20 19:14:47 -0600 (Sat, 20 Dec 2008) | 1 line
      
        there are way too many places which need to have the current version added
      ................
        r67892 | benjamin.peterson | 2008-12-20 19:29:32 -0600 (Sat, 20 Dec 2008) | 9 lines
      
        Merged revisions 67809 via svnmerge from
        svn+ssh://pythondev@svn.python.org/sandbox/trunk/2to3/lib2to3
      
        ........
          r67809 | benjamin.peterson | 2008-12-15 21:54:45 -0600 (Mon, 15 Dec 2008) | 1 line
      
          fix logic error
        ........
      ................
        r67895 | neal.norwitz | 2008-12-21 08:28:32 -0600 (Sun, 21 Dec 2008) | 2 lines
      
        Add Tarek for work on distutils.
      ................
        r67898 | benjamin.peterson | 2008-12-21 15:00:53 -0600 (Sun, 21 Dec 2008) | 1 line
      
        compute DISTVERSION with patchlevel.py
      ................
        r67904 | benjamin.peterson | 2008-12-22 14:44:58 -0600 (Mon, 22 Dec 2008) | 1 line
      
        less attitude
      ................
        r67905 | benjamin.peterson | 2008-12-22 14:51:15 -0600 (Mon, 22 Dec 2008) | 1 line
      
        fix #4720: the format to PyArg_ParseTupleAndKeywords can now start with '|'
      ................
        r67906 | benjamin.peterson | 2008-12-22 14:52:53 -0600 (Mon, 22 Dec 2008) | 1 line
      
        add NEWS note
      ................
        r67907 | benjamin.peterson | 2008-12-22 16:12:19 -0600 (Mon, 22 Dec 2008) | 1 line
      
        silence compiler warning
      ................
        r67912 | georg.brandl | 2008-12-23 06:37:21 -0600 (Tue, 23 Dec 2008) | 2 lines
      
        Fix missing "svn" command.
      ................
        r67918 | georg.brandl | 2008-12-23 09:44:25 -0600 (Tue, 23 Dec 2008) | 2 lines
      
        Markup fix.
      ................
        r67920 | benjamin.peterson | 2008-12-23 14:09:28 -0600 (Tue, 23 Dec 2008) | 1 line
      
        use a global variable, so the compiler doesn't optimize the assignment out
      ................
        r67921 | benjamin.peterson | 2008-12-23 14:12:33 -0600 (Tue, 23 Dec 2008) | 1 line
      
        make global static
      ................
        r67923 | benjamin.peterson | 2008-12-24 09:10:27 -0600 (Wed, 24 Dec 2008) | 1 line
      
        #4736 BufferRWPair.closed shouldn't try to call another property as a function
      ................
        r67924 | benjamin.peterson | 2008-12-24 10:10:05 -0600 (Wed, 24 Dec 2008) | 1 line
      
        pretend exceptions don't exist a while longer
      ................
        r67926 | tarek.ziade | 2008-12-24 13:10:05 -0600 (Wed, 24 Dec 2008) | 1 line
      
        fixed #4400 : distutils .pypirc default generated file was broken.
      ................
        r67927 | benjamin.peterson | 2008-12-26 17:26:30 -0600 (Fri, 26 Dec 2008) | 1 line
      
        python version is included in file name now
      ................
        r67930 | hirokazu.yamamoto | 2008-12-26 22:19:48 -0600 (Fri, 26 Dec 2008) | 2 lines
      
        Issue #4740: Use HIGHEST_PROTOCOL in pickle test.
        (There is no behavior difference in 2.x because HIGHEST_PROTOCOL == 2)
      ................
        r67943 | alexandre.vassalotti | 2008-12-27 04:02:59 -0600 (Sat, 27 Dec 2008) | 2 lines
      
        Fix bogus unicode tests in pickletester.
      ................
      9203501b
    • Antoine Pitrou's avatar
      Merged revisions 67946 via svnmerge from · db5fe667
      Antoine Pitrou authored
      svn+ssh://pythondev@svn.python.org/python/trunk
      
      ........
        r67946 | antoine.pitrou | 2008-12-27 16:43:12 +0100 (sam., 27 déc. 2008) | 4 lines
      
        Issue #4756: zipfile.is_zipfile() now supports file-like objects.
        Patch by Gabriel Genellina.
      ........
      db5fe667
    • Hirokazu Yamamoto's avatar
      Fixed incompatible pointer warning. · d88e8fab
      Hirokazu Yamamoto authored
      d88e8fab
    • Alexandre Vassalotti's avatar
      Blocked revisions 67934-67935 via svnmerge · 0c6225f0
      Alexandre Vassalotti authored
      ........
        r67934 | alexandre.vassalotti | 2008-12-27 02:08:47 -0500 (Sat, 27 Dec 2008) | 4 lines
      
        Fix issue #4730: cPickle corrupts high-unicode strings.
        Update outdated copy of PyUnicode_EncodeRawUnicodeEscape.
        Add a test case.
      ........
        r67935 | alexandre.vassalotti | 2008-12-27 02:13:01 -0500 (Sat, 27 Dec 2008) | 2 lines
      
        Add Misc/NEWS entry for r67934.
      ........
      0c6225f0
    • Alexandre Vassalotti's avatar
      Fix bogus assertion. · bad1b921
      Alexandre Vassalotti authored
      bad1b921
    • Alexandre Vassalotti's avatar
      Fix issue #4374: Pickle tests fail w/o _pickle extension. · 3cfcab95
      Alexandre Vassalotti authored
      Add an initialization check to mimic the interface of _pickle.
      3cfcab95
    • Alexandre Vassalotti's avatar
      Optimize built-in unicode codecs by avoiding unnecessary copying. · 44531cb2
      Alexandre Vassalotti authored
      The approach used is similiar to what is currently used in the version
      of unicodeobject.c in Python 2.x. The only difference is we use
      _PyBytes_Resize instead of _PyString_Resize.
      44531cb2
    • Alexandre Vassalotti's avatar
      Fix wrong bytes type conversion in PyUnicode_AsUnicodeEscapeString. · 9cb6f7f7
      Alexandre Vassalotti authored
      Fix wrong bytes type conversion in PyUnicode_AsUnicodeDecodeString.
      9cb6f7f7
    • Alexandre Vassalotti's avatar
      Update copy of PyUnicode_EncodeRawUnicodeEscape in _pickle. · 554d878b
      Alexandre Vassalotti authored
      Add astral character test case.
      554d878b
    • Alexandre Vassalotti's avatar
      Merged revisions 67932 via svnmerge from · aa0e531e
      Alexandre Vassalotti authored
      svn+ssh://pythondev@svn.python.org/python/trunk
      
      ........
        r67932 | alexandre.vassalotti | 2008-12-27 01:36:10 -0500 (Sat, 27 Dec 2008) | 5 lines
      
        Remove unnecessary casts related to unicode_decode_call_errorhandler.
        Make the _PyUnicode_Resize macro a static function.
      
        These changes are needed to avoid breaking strict aliasing rules.
      ........
      aa0e531e